The Basics of Serverless Compute

To kick things off, let's clarify what "serverless" actually denotes in this context. It's not about the absence of servers—after all, the cloud doesn't exist in a vacuum. Instead, serverless compute refers to a pricing model that automatically scales compute resources based on workload demand—and that’s a game changer for many organizations.

How Does It Work?

Now, you might be wondering, "How does this automatic scaling magic happen?" In the realm of Azure SQL Database, the serverless model tracks resource consumption actively. It analyzes the database's performance and usage patterns, stepping in like a good host to make sure everything’s running smoothly—without you having to micromanage it.

This means if there's a sudden spike in user activity or data processing tasks, Azure can ramp up the resources to meet the demand. Conversely, during quieter periods, it leans back and conserves resources. This can prevent those oh-so-frustrating slowdowns while keeping costs manageable. Cost Savings: More Than Just a Perk

Speaking of cost savings, let’s break this down a little further. Utilizing a model that charges based on the compute time actually used rather than reserved capacity makes savvy financial sense. So, you won't be stuck paying for resources that sit idle. In today's fast-paced business world, this ability to optimize costs can have a considerable impact on a company's bottom line.
